Title: Unlisted
Filename: unlisted.xm
Posted Thu 6th May 1999
Rated 7 / 10
This techno module is very well composed. It's a little bit monotonous, but what ever can I expect when the whole song is made in less than an hour! The drums are very good, but it's actually the same over and over again. A little minus for that. The piano is a bit unralistic, but it's working. A clap for the breaks/fill-ins, it's getting up the Groove-factor. GOOD WORK OF ANDREAS! The samplequality is good and it dosn't sound noisy. This xm is complicated, and a plus for the little time Andreas used. No out-of-tunes, no bad timings and the lame ending is good as well. This module can you SAFELY download.....:)
